Assessing the impact of energy coaching with smart technology interventions to alleviate energy poverty
Joseph Llewellyn1,2,3, Titus Venverloo4,5, Fabio Duarte6
1Sustainable Development, Environmental Science and Engineering Department, KTH Royal Institute of Technology, Teknikringen 10b, Stockholm, 114 28, Sweden. josephll@kth.se.
Abstract:
Energy poverty affects 550,000 homes in the Netherlands yet policy interventions to alleviate this issue are rare. Therefore, we test two energy coaching interventions in Amsterdam: a static information group (n = 67) which received energy efficient products and one energy-use report, and a smart information group (n = 50), which also had a display providing real-time feedback on energy-use. Results across both groups, show a 75% success rate for alleviating energy poverty. On average homes reduced monthly electricity consumption by 62 kWh (33%), gas by 41 m3 (42%), bills by €104 (53%) and percentage of income spent on energy from 10.1% to 5.3%.
